Why was she seeking a VAWA self-petition versus other routes to citizenship?

0

Sean: In a typical petition for immigration status submitted by a citizen and immigrant couple, there is a waiting period followed by a series of interviews that both the husband and wife must attend in order for the noncitizen to obtain permanent lawful status in this country. With the VAWA self-petition, abuse victims don’t have to rely on the abuser – the US citizen – to attend the interview or otherwise sponsor them. In fact, the parameters of the self-petition specify that nothing in it can be shared with the abuser. Ideally, the victim should be able to go through the process start-to-finish without the abuser ever knowing. Melissa: Also, U visas and T visas have different eligibility requirements. U visas are designed for victims of crime who aid the police or prosecutor in bringing a case against the perpetrators of the crime. T visas are for trafficking victims.
